Okey Memory Cafe goers got a virtual reality experience on Tuesday (June 27) as part of the week's session to the delight of many.

Ryan Arthurs from Okehampton's very own VR centre Immersion came to the cafe with a VR headset to allow members to visit the beach and wood from their seats.

The session also saw members try out a trickshaw (a rickshaw with three wheels)
